Updated INFO.yaml file
[ric-app/kpimon.git] / asn1c_defs / all-defs / ProcedureCode.h
1 /*\r
2  * Generated by asn1c-0.9.29 (http://lionet.info/asn1c)\r
3  * From ASN.1 module "X2AP-CommonDataTypes"\r
4  *      found in "../../asn_defs/asn1/x2ap-modified-15-05.asn"\r
5  *      `asn1c -fcompound-names -fno-include-deps -findirect-choice -gen-PER -no-gen-OER`\r
6  */\r
7 \r
8 #ifndef _ProcedureCode_H_\r
9 #define _ProcedureCode_H_\r
10 \r
11 \r
12 #include <asn_application.h>\r
13 \r
14 /* Including external dependencies */\r
15 #include <NativeInteger.h>\r
16 \r
17 #ifdef __cplusplus\r
18 extern "C" {\r
19 #endif\r
20 \r
21 /* ProcedureCode */\r
22 typedef long     ProcedureCode_t;\r
23 \r
24 /* Implementation */\r
25 #define ProcedureCode_id_ricSubscription        ((ProcedureCode_t)201)\r
26 #define ProcedureCode_id_ricSubscriptionDelete  ((ProcedureCode_t)202)\r
27 #define ProcedureCode_id_ricServiceUpdate       ((ProcedureCode_t)203)\r
28 #define ProcedureCode_id_ricControl     ((ProcedureCode_t)204)\r
29 #define ProcedureCode_id_ricIndication  ((ProcedureCode_t)205)\r
30 #define ProcedureCode_id_ricServiceQuery        ((ProcedureCode_t)206)\r
31 extern asn_per_constraints_t asn_PER_type_ProcedureCode_constr_1;\r
32 extern asn_TYPE_descriptor_t asn_DEF_ProcedureCode;\r
33 asn_struct_free_f ProcedureCode_free;\r
34 asn_struct_print_f ProcedureCode_print;\r
35 asn_constr_check_f ProcedureCode_constraint;\r
36 ber_type_decoder_f ProcedureCode_decode_ber;\r
37 der_type_encoder_f ProcedureCode_encode_der;\r
38 xer_type_decoder_f ProcedureCode_decode_xer;\r
39 xer_type_encoder_f ProcedureCode_encode_xer;\r
40 per_type_decoder_f ProcedureCode_decode_uper;\r
41 per_type_encoder_f ProcedureCode_encode_uper;\r
42 per_type_decoder_f ProcedureCode_decode_aper;\r
43 per_type_encoder_f ProcedureCode_encode_aper;\r
44 #define ProcedureCode_id_handoverPreparation    ((ProcedureCode_t)0)\r
45 #define ProcedureCode_id_handoverCancel ((ProcedureCode_t)1)\r
46 #define ProcedureCode_id_loadIndication ((ProcedureCode_t)2)\r
47 #define ProcedureCode_id_errorIndication        ((ProcedureCode_t)3)\r
48 #define ProcedureCode_id_snStatusTransfer       ((ProcedureCode_t)4)\r
49 #define ProcedureCode_id_uEContextRelease       ((ProcedureCode_t)5)\r
50 #define ProcedureCode_id_x2Setup        ((ProcedureCode_t)6)\r
51 #define ProcedureCode_id_reset  ((ProcedureCode_t)7)\r
52 #define ProcedureCode_id_eNBConfigurationUpdate ((ProcedureCode_t)8)\r
53 #define ProcedureCode_id_resourceStatusReportingInitiation      ((ProcedureCode_t)9)\r
54 #define ProcedureCode_id_resourceStatusReporting        ((ProcedureCode_t)10)\r
55 #define ProcedureCode_id_privateMessage ((ProcedureCode_t)11)\r
56 #define ProcedureCode_id_mobilitySettingsChange ((ProcedureCode_t)12)\r
57 #define ProcedureCode_id_rLFIndication  ((ProcedureCode_t)13)\r
58 #define ProcedureCode_id_handoverReport ((ProcedureCode_t)14)\r
59 #define ProcedureCode_id_cellActivation ((ProcedureCode_t)15)\r
60 #define ProcedureCode_id_x2Release      ((ProcedureCode_t)16)\r
61 #define ProcedureCode_id_x2APMessageTransfer    ((ProcedureCode_t)17)\r
62 #define ProcedureCode_id_x2Removal      ((ProcedureCode_t)18)\r
63 #define ProcedureCode_id_seNBAdditionPreparation        ((ProcedureCode_t)19)\r
64 #define ProcedureCode_id_seNBReconfigurationCompletion  ((ProcedureCode_t)20)\r
65 #define ProcedureCode_id_meNBinitiatedSeNBModificationPreparation       ((ProcedureCode_t)21)\r
66 #define ProcedureCode_id_seNBinitiatedSeNBModification  ((ProcedureCode_t)22)\r
67 #define ProcedureCode_id_meNBinitiatedSeNBRelease       ((ProcedureCode_t)23)\r
68 #define ProcedureCode_id_seNBinitiatedSeNBRelease       ((ProcedureCode_t)24)\r
69 #define ProcedureCode_id_seNBCounterCheck       ((ProcedureCode_t)25)\r
70 #define ProcedureCode_id_retrieveUEContext      ((ProcedureCode_t)26)\r
71 #define ProcedureCode_id_sgNBAdditionPreparation        ((ProcedureCode_t)27)\r
72 #define ProcedureCode_id_sgNBReconfigurationCompletion  ((ProcedureCode_t)28)\r
73 #define ProcedureCode_id_meNBinitiatedSgNBModificationPreparation       ((ProcedureCode_t)29)\r
74 #define ProcedureCode_id_sgNBinitiatedSgNBModification  ((ProcedureCode_t)30)\r
75 #define ProcedureCode_id_meNBinitiatedSgNBRelease       ((ProcedureCode_t)31)\r
76 #define ProcedureCode_id_sgNBinitiatedSgNBRelease       ((ProcedureCode_t)32)\r
77 #define ProcedureCode_id_sgNBCounterCheck       ((ProcedureCode_t)33)\r
78 #define ProcedureCode_id_sgNBChange     ((ProcedureCode_t)34)\r
79 #define ProcedureCode_id_rRCTransfer    ((ProcedureCode_t)35)\r
80 #define ProcedureCode_id_endcX2Setup    ((ProcedureCode_t)36)\r
81 #define ProcedureCode_id_endcConfigurationUpdate        ((ProcedureCode_t)37)\r
82 #define ProcedureCode_id_secondaryRATDataUsageReport    ((ProcedureCode_t)38)\r
83 #define ProcedureCode_id_endcCellActivation     ((ProcedureCode_t)39)\r
84 #define ProcedureCode_id_endcPartialReset       ((ProcedureCode_t)40)\r
85 #define ProcedureCode_id_eUTRANRCellResourceCoordination        ((ProcedureCode_t)41)\r
86 #define ProcedureCode_id_SgNBActivityNotification       ((ProcedureCode_t)42)\r
87 #define ProcedureCode_id_endcX2Removal  ((ProcedureCode_t)43)\r
88 #define ProcedureCode_id_dataForwardingAddressIndication        ((ProcedureCode_t)44)\r
89 #define ProcedureCode_id_gNBStatusIndication    ((ProcedureCode_t)45)\r
90 #define ProcedureCode_id_kPIMonitor     ((ProcedureCode_t)46)\r
91 \r
92 #ifdef __cplusplus\r
93 }\r
94 #endif\r
95 \r
96 #endif  /* _ProcedureCode_H_ */\r
97 #include <asn_internal.h>\r